Following is worth exactly .02...mine...lol
dead straight in front. Wink of toe in or out if you want but trying to reduce scrub.
Rf 2.5 camber
LF 3 camber
rt rear 1.75 camber
Lt rear 2 deg camber
Toe in 2.5 to 3 mm total in rear 1.2 to 1.5 per side
Run car low and flat. Flatten wing as you build comfort. Car will feel edgy.
